Fifty-seven middle schools students were inducted into the National Junior Honor Society on Tuesday, May 20, 2008 during a candlelight ceremony. CHMS Multicultural Day CHMS sponsored a Multicultural Program on May 16, 2008. Students dispalyed their talents in a broad range of performances. Special guests from Tyler Junior College added to the excitement and enjoyment of the program. |

Carol Morgan was named Teacher of the Year for the Middle School for her outstanding work as an English as Second Language teacher. Morgan was also named earlier in the year as the Teacher of the Third Six Weeks. Congratulations Mrs. Morgan!
